Abstract

Cochlear implant (CI) surgery in specific situations necessitates a different surgical technique. The objective of subtotal petrosectomy (STP) with closure of the external auditory canal (EAC) and eustachian tube (ET), combined to cavity obliteration with abdominal fat, is to isolate the cavity from the external environment. Moreover, this technique can be used to obtain an easier access to and better visibility of the middle ear and cochlea. The decision to perform STP is not taken lightly when normal hearing is still present, but in a CI candidate, this consideration is of importance only if residual hearing is present and electroacoustic stimulation is intended. Finally, an STP should be performed and preferred to a standard cochlear implantation technique in the presence of otitis media, cholesteatoma, cochlear ossification, inner ear malformation or fracture of the temporal bone.
